Enlargement of an arteriovenous malformation documented by angiography. Case report.

R F Spetzler, C B Wilson.   

Abstract

The authors present a case in which an enlarging arteriovenous malformation was documented angiographically. Enlargement of the malformation concurrent with the appearence of basilar artery insufficiency was ascribed to a sump effect (steal) by the arteriovenous shunt.
